What is Dental Bonding?

Dental Bonding is a procedure by which composite resin material closely matching the colour of the patient’s teeth is adhered to the tooth to cosmetically enhance its appearance and colour. A curing light, either ultraviolet rays or a laser beam is used to harden the resin.  It takes about 60 to 90 minutes to perform.  

Is Dental Bonding painful?

There is no preparation required for bonding and the procedure is pain free. No anaesthetic is required unless the dentist feel there is the need to perform some drilling.  

When can I travel by air after Dental Bonding?

Patients can travel by air immediately after a dental bonding procedure unless the dentist advises them against travel.  

How long does recovery after Dental Bonding take?

If local anaesthesia is administered, patients may feel uncomfortable till the anaesthesia wears off. The anaesthesia will wear off in a few hours. Dental bonding is a pain free procedure.  

How do I care for my teeth after Dental Bonding?

Patients should not drink beverages or eat food that may stain teeth for at least two days. They should brush and floss their teeth regularly and maintain overall good oral hygiene. They should use a soft toothbrush while brushing teeth. They should avoid biting hard objects or eating hard food items. They should stop smoking and drink water after every meal.

What are the alternatives to dental bonding?

Alternatives to dental bonding include teeth whitening procedures, fitting veneers or fitting dental crowns.
